Education minister helps faculty mark its 40th year

The Hon. Paul Ramsey, Minister of Education, Skills and Training,
will be a special guest speaker as the University of British
Columbia’s Faculty of Education celebrates its 40th anniversary.

UBC President Martha Piper is also a featured speaker at
the celebration’s opening ceremony, on Friday, Oct. 17 at
4 p.m. in the main lobby of the Neville Scarfe building, 2125
Main Mall.

On Saturday, Oct. 18, a day-long open house showcases the
faculty’s activities with lectures, displays and demonstrations.
Alumni, faculty, staff, students and their families are welcome
to attend. Faculty and class reunions will also be held throughout
the day.

The open house takes place from 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. in the
Scarfe building.

The Faculty of Education contributes greatly to education
in the province by preparing teachers for a broad range of
responsibilities in schools and by offering teachers further
professional development opportunities. More than half of
all teachers in B.C. are graduates of UBC’s Faculty of Education.

As well, 144 faculty members conduct research in areas ranging
from daycare and early childhood education to gerontology
education and exercise science.
